    I have the opportunity to branch out into a completely different business area. If I go ahead, I’d like to use my name as the business name. If that’s the case, will I need to register it?

    Also, am I right in thinking that I can use my existing ABN as I will be in the same business structure (i.e. sole trader)?

    bridiej, post: 120093 wrote:
    I have the opportunity to branch out into a completely different business area. If I go ahead, I’d like to use my name as the business name. If that’s the case, will I need to register it?

    No, you don’t need to register a business name if you are trading as your own name. Just don’t add any extra words to it, like “super” or “extraordinaire” ;)

    Also, am I right in thinking that I can use my existing ABN as I will be in the same business structure (i.e. sole trader)?

    Yes, as long as your ABN is current, it will apply to all new business names.

    Just to elaborate a tiny bit on Wendy’s reply – you can’t add any extra words to your name – not even a purely descriptive word. I also believe that it needs to be your full name, otherwise you would have to register – i.e. “B Jenner” would still require registration.
